Some features of audio visual systems featuring video projection include: Visual Hymnal - Keep the focus at the pulpit. Eliminate traditional hymnals by placing hymn and song lyrics on retractable screens; a creative way to display religious imagery and church messages. Overflow - Slim-profile plasma or projection screens in hall or overflow areas offer a streaming video presentation of Worship Services and Celebrations. Presentations - Educational and religious films can be displayed for vivid wide-screen viewing. Security - Video as part of a church AV system can perform as a church security system.
